The Ugly Fruit Group aims to beat hunger by reducing food waste, via the three pillars: reusing, donating and educating. Fresh produce of all shapes and sizes are just as delicious. So, we gather and distribute surplus fruit and vegetables from wholesalers/supermarkets which is otherwise destined for the waste.
WeCraft tackles social isolation through their creative workshop which offers sessions ranging from classes on still life art to original poetry readings. Community is at the heart of what we do: we are an organisation crafted by the community, for the community.
Our vision is to empower formerly unemployed youths in Kibera with entrepreneurship and employment that can support their community in the form of a Swap Shop: Taka Taka Zero. We want to contribute to the sustainable reduction of plastic and food waste, whilst providing healthy foods to impoverished families.
Glowcycle provides a community for female ex-prisoners through a variety of creative and skill-based workshops. Via the use of various individual and group based activities, we aim to help improve the employability and social skills of previously incarcerated women.
Trashion is our innovative response to fast fashion and over-consumption.
Our annual fundraising exhibition features garments made from repurposed and donated waste material. We raise awareness about the polluting impact of the fashion industry while showcasing a new mindset; rethink, recycle, repurpose.
The Incubation Team draws together the most creative and entrepreneurial minds in Durham University to brainstorm project ideas and assess the potential social impact of project ideas on beneficiaries. Utilising resources from business advisers, fresh ideas can be harnessed to achieve their maximum potential.
